Capture 3D Scanner from Geomagic

By |2018-03-12T20:58:51-04:00March 12th, 2018|Categories: 2 Minute Tuesdays, 3D Scanning / Reverse Engineering, CQTV|0 Comments

https://cimquesttv.wistia.com/medias/512rp48o8h?embedType=async&videoFoam=true&videoWidth=640   The Capture 3D Scanner from Geomagic can be used for both reverse engineering and inspection. It allows you to bring physical parts into CAD, for the purpose of reviving a lost design, developing entirely new products, or inspecting existing parts. Lubrizol Introduces First 3D Printing Materials

By |2018-03-05T08:38:22-05:00March 5th, 2018|Categories: 3D Printing / Additive Mfg, HP Multi Jet Fusion Technology|0 Comments

(Reprint from https://www.tctmagazine.com) Parts manufactured in TPU with the Multi Jet Fusion process. Lubrizol, a specialty chemicals company, has introduced its first three 3D printing material products after its entry into the additive market. The Ohio-based company has followed the likes of BASF, SABIC, and Clariant into the industry to offer its expertise, particularly in the development of th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) materials, to those pushing AM from a prototyping tool to a volume [...]

HP Unveils 4 Lower-Cost Jet Fusion 3D Printers

By |2018-03-02T08:38:01-05:00March 2nd, 2018|Categories: 3D Printing / Additive Mfg, HP Multi Jet Fusion Technology|0 Comments

HP Inc. recently revealed the next evolution of its 3D printing business with the unveiling of four new Jet Fusion 3D printer models that will feature the same technology of the original models, but with a smaller footprint and lower cost to reach a broader set of customers. The expanded Jet Fusion lineup will include models that can print full-color objects as well as models that just do black-and-white. Capabilities include printing at high speeds—up [...]
